Player Story

JC Jackson story

JC Jackson built his college career from 2016 through 2017 as a defensive back from Immokalee, FL wearing No. 7, spending time with Maryland. The clearest part of JC Jackson's career was his defensive production: 80 tackles, 2 tackles for loss, 4 interceptions, and 13 passes defended across 24 career games in the available record. His largest box-score season came in 2017 with Maryland. Those numbers show where he fit, how often the ball or action found him, and how his role developed over time.
